The Principles of Smart Shopping

There are several key principles that guide smart shopping. Among them are:

  1. Preparation: Research before purchasing. This includes comparing prices, reading reviews, and checking for discounts or promotions.
  2. Patience: Unless it’s an immediate necessity, it’s often beneficial to wait for the right price or a sale.
  3. Practicality: Opt for products that offer value and serviceability rather than being swayed by brand names or trends.
  4. Prioritization: Stick to your shopping list and don’t let impulsive buying detract from your budgeting goals.

I have found that these principles can be applied universally, whether you’re grocery shopping or purchasing high-ticket items such as electronics or furniture. They have personally helped me to make informed decisions, avoid buyer’s remorse, and keep my budget in check.

How To Master the Art of Smart Shopping

Mastering the art of smart shopping might seem daunting initially, but here are a few tactics that have helped me along the journey:
Learn to shop off-season: Retailers often discount seasonal merchandise such as clothing or garden tools to make room for new stock. Shopping off-season has allowed me to buy quality products at a lower price.
Use cashback applications and reward programs: Apps like Rakuten or Shopkick give back a percentage of the money spent. Similarly, many stores offer reward programs with member exclusives and discounts. I’ve received significant cash back and savings from these services, which adds up over time.
Consider used and refurbished items: Used goods, particularly refurbished electronics, are often in excellent condition and much cheaper. It’s been a cost-effective strategy for me.

Understanding Unit Pricing

Another smart shopping strategy involves paying attention to unit pricing. This tells you how much a product costs per unit—a useful tool when comparing product prices. By looking at the unit price, shoppers can ensure that they’re truly getting the best deal, especially when it comes to bulk purchases.

Embracing a Mindset of Value Over Quantity

One of the most impactful ways to make your money stretch further is by adopting a mindset that prioritizes value over quantity. Purchasing high-quality items that last longer and meet your needs more effectively may initially cost more, but these choices can save you money in the long run.
Consider, for instance, the timeless wisdom of buying a good pair of durable shoes. A more expensive pair may initially seem like a big investment, but if those shoes last you several years as opposed to a few months, you’ve achieved a higher value for your money.

Buying in Bulk and Meal Planning

Did you know that buying in bulk can save considerable money over time? Items like household essentials often come at a cheaper unit price when purchased in larger quantities.
Similarly, meal planning and shopping for groceries in one fell swoop can minimize wastage and save money. Where possible, aim to base your meals around sales and discounts of the week, and remember, buying only what you’ll genuinely consume is the real saving!
